

Ruby Avinia King Rogers, age 90, passed from this life to the arms of her Lord on July 25, 2011. She was preceded in death by her husband of 45 years, Arthur Rogers, her daughter the Rev. Carol Rogers Thornton, her parents, Tom and Susan King: her brothers Ken, Tom and Frank King. Mrs. Rogers remained a citizen of Great Britain, even after her marriage to her beloved American G.I., and her subsequent 60-plus yeas of living in Richmond, VA. She served proudly in the Auxillary Territorial Service (ATS) of Great Britain During World War II; and later, worked for many years at the State Corporation Commission.
